The kitchen is the heart of the home, and it’s no wonder that homeowners are always looking for ways to make their kitchens both functional and beautiful. In the year 2023, kitchen design will continue to evolve with new ideas that reflect the changing needs of homeowners.

One of the biggest kitchen trends for 2023 in the UK will be the use of smart technology. From smart appliances to voice-activated controls, kitchens will be equipped with the latest gadgets to make life easier and more convenient. Imagine being able to preheat your oven just by asking Alexa or Google Assistant!

Another kitchen trend to watch out for in 2023 is the use of bold colors and patterns. If you’re tired of neutral kitchens, you’ll be happy to know that bright and vibrant colors will be on trend. Think bold blues, greens, and yellows for kitchen cabinets, backsplashes, and walls.

In addition to bold colors, homeowners will also be incorporating more natural finishes into their kitchens. Wood, stone, and other organic materials will be used to create a warm and inviting atmosphere. This trend will also extend to kitchen accessories and decor, with natural elements like woven baskets and potted plants becoming more popular.

Open-plan kitchens will remain a popular choice in 2023, with homeowners in the UK opting for more seamless transitions between their kitchens and living spaces. This design trend allows for more natural light and better flow between rooms, making the kitchen a more inviting space for entertaining friends and family.

Finally, sustainability will continue to be a key focus in modern kitchen design. Homeowners will be looking for ways to reduce waste and lower their carbon footprint. This could include everything from using energy-efficient appliances to incorporating recycled materials into kitchen design.
